Output 7543b0603667d7d8de6112ae866d21ed1336fc00f05fc7fd040a636bc8be513f:1

value
3327640
script pubkey
OP_0 OP_PUSHBYTES_20 7eb35621608cfd3ead817e00ed008f489902fb95
address
ltc1q06e4vgtq3n7natvp0cqw6qy0fzvs97u423cep9
transaction
7543b0603667d7d8de6112ae866d21ed1336fc00f05fc7fd040a636bc8be513f
spent
true